The occurrence of allergic skin diseases in children has doubled in recent years, due to an increased use of children make-up and other cosmeticsZurich/Venice, 9 November 2010 – Allergic skin diseases are increasing at an alarming rate among children due to the indiscriminate use of nonhypoallergenic make-up, the European Academy for Allergy and Clinical Immunology (EAACI) warns on the eve of its “Skin Allergy Meeting” held in Venice, Italy, Nov. 11-13.
